| View previous topic :: View next topic |
| Author |
Message |
MrMike19597 Voice
Joined: 07 Jul 2005 Posts: 30
|
Posted: Fri Apr 20, 2007 4:06 am Post subject: Telnet says cannot restart using -n |
|
|
| ok lets see where to start ... all the problems lol i spent days configuring the firewall to let me telnet .. finally i get things going but when i ./eggdrop -m eggdrop.conf it loads fine but it will not go to the server unless i do ./eggdrop -m eggdrop.conf -n so i have the user file an everything made an i can telnet... but now i cant .restart it says you cannot .restart while using -n and then something about TCL? now if i remove the -n an start the bot without the -n it will still not go to the server and its not giving me any reason why, any suggestions?? |
|
| Back to top |
|
 |
DragnLord Owner

Joined: 24 Jan 2004 Posts: 711 Location: C'ville, Virginia, USA
|
Posted: Fri Apr 20, 2007 9:32 am Post subject: |
|
|
./eggdrop -ntm eggdrop.conf
this should allow you to see why it's not connecting properly |
|
| Back to top |
|
 |
nml375 Revered One
Joined: 04 Aug 2006 Posts: 2857
|
Posted: Fri Apr 20, 2007 10:14 am Post subject: |
|
|
This would sound like a pthread/fork issue. I would guess that the tcl-library you're using was compiled with threads enabled, which now causes problems when your eggdrop tries to fork() into background (using -n or -nt prevents forking, and hence your eggdrop will suddenly appear to work without any problems. Unfortunately, because of tcl, you cannot use .restart when not launched into background). _________________ NML_375, idling at #eggdrop@IrcNET |
|
| Back to top |
|
 |
MrMike19597 Voice
Joined: 07 Jul 2005 Posts: 30
|
Posted: Fri Apr 20, 2007 1:39 pm Post subject: |
|
|
ok here is what i am getting
[06:28] net: connect! sock 5
[06:28] DNS resolved xx.xx.xxx.xxx to xxxxx
[06:28] Telnet connection: xxxxx/3330
[06:28] net: connect! sock 11
[06:28] net: eof!(write) socket 11 (Connection refused,111)
[06:28] Timeout/EOF ident connection
[06:28] Logged in: Mike(telnet@wxxxxx/3330)
[06:28] tcl: builtin dcc call: *dcc:save Mike 10
[06:28] Writing user file...
[06:28] Writing channel file...
[06:28] tcl: builtin dcc call: *dcc:restart Mike 10
[06:28] #Mike# restart |
|
| Back to top |
|
 |
DragnLord Owner

Joined: 24 Jan 2004 Posts: 711 Location: C'ville, Virginia, USA
|
Posted: Fri Apr 20, 2007 11:53 pm Post subject: |
|
|
wow, that's actually an error I haven't seen before
hopefully nml375, or one of the other devs, can shed some light on what's going on.
I wouldn't think it's a threaded TCL issue since all of my servers use threaded TCL and I haven't had any problems like this with eggdrops on any of them. |
|
| Back to top |
|
 |
|